Best Mothers Day Quotes
“A mother is she who can take the place of all others but whose place no one else can take.” – Cardinal Mermillod
This quote tells us how unique a mother is. No one can fill the role of a mom in our lives. It’s a heartfelt reminder of how much they shape our experiences and memories. We often lean on our mothers for understanding, support, and love. Their place is irreplaceable, and we should celebrate this on Mother’s Day and beyond.
Mothers provide a foundation of strength for us, guiding and nurturing in ways that make them stand out in our hearts. This acknowledgment makes us appreciate everything they do, from daily routines to extraordinary sacrifices. It serves as a beautiful reminder of the special bond between mothers and their children.
“The influence of a mother in the lives of her children is beyond calculation.” – James E. Faust
This quote highlights the immense impact mothers have on our lives. Their influence shapes our values, beliefs, and how we see the world. We may not always realize it, but our mothers instill lessons and strengths in us that stay for a lifetime. They are our first teachers, showing us how to navigate life.
“There is no way to be a perfect mother and a million ways to be a good one.” – Jill Churchill
“Motherhood: All love begins and ends there.” – Robert Browning
“To describe my mother would be to write about a hurricane in its perfect power.” – Maya Angelou
“All that I am, or hope to be, I owe to my angel mother.” – Abraham Lincoln
“A mother’s arms are made of tenderness and children sleep soundly in them.” – Victor Hugo
“Being a mother is learning about strengths you didn’t know you had.” – Linda Wooten
“Motherhood is the greatest thing and the hardest thing.” – Rickie Solinger
“A mother is not a person to lean on, but a person to make leaning unnecessary.” – Dorothy Canfield Fisher
“A mother’s love is more beautiful than any fresh flower.” – Debasish Mridha
“Mother: the most beautiful word on the lips of mankind.” – Khalil Gibran
“Mothers hold their children’s hands for a short while, but their hearts forever.” – Anonymous
“Being a mother is not about what you gave up to have a child, but what you’ve gained from having one.” – Sylvia B. Earle
“A mother is the one who knows us the best and loves us the most.” – Anonymous
“Motherhood is the exquisite inconvenience of being another person’s everything.” – Unknown
“Life doesn’t come with a manual, it comes with a mother.” – Unknown
“There is no force of nature more powerful than a mother’s love.” – Unknown
“The best place to cry is on a mother’s arms.” – Jodi Picoult
“A mother’s love is like a compass that always points you in the right direction.” – Unknown
“Mother: the heartbeat of the home.” – Anonymous
“A mother’s hug lasts long after she lets go.” – Anonymous
